  2. For me it depends on the archetype. I find for Stalkers, I have a much easier time increasing the enemy difficulty, than increasing the mobs. I'd rather fight a +3 or +4 Lt and two minions, than say 1 yellow mob and 5 white. Currently on my level 23 Ice/Energy tanker, I'm fighting at +0x3 because I have icicles, Chilling embrace(with some dmg procs) and Whirling hands. So usually by the time I take out a Lt etc, most of the mobs are dead or nearly there. I sometimes gather 2 or more enemy groups this way, and it's working pretty good. For a Blaster, I generally go with more mobs. Once I'm at -1x8 or 0x8, I'll start bumping up the difficulty. I seldom do something like +2x3. At that point I'd rather go +4x1, or -1x6 etc. If you have a lot of single target damage, then try increasing difficulty. If you have a lot of AoE, try increasing the team size.

  12. If you have a lot of aoe, I generally increase number of enemies first. If I have more single target damage, I increase the enemy level first. Once I find content while levelling a bit easy, I might start at 0x3, and go from there. My stalker was pretty good Single target damage, so he generally went up to +4x1, and then increased the number of enemies until his issue was endurance in longer fights. You just have to figure out which is the most efficient for your AT. Sometimes +2x2 is better than +0x4. IT all depends how your Character performs.
  13. It will go over 45%, but that only helps you if you get debuffed. The softcap is still 45%, whether you have 45% or 60%. But if you take a hit for -10% def at 60%...you will still be at 50%. The hard cap for defence is 95% I believe...which the game will not allow you to exceed.
